Speaking of strength...

There is this little girl in my coverage area who has a big heart and a lot of strength.

When she was 10, she was diagnosed with Ewing's Sarcoma, a rare cancer that attacks bones and soft tissue. Almost a year after her first diagnosis, after surgeries, 'pokes,' hospital stays and chemo, her family thought they were in the clear.

Just two weeks ago, though, a routine CT scan found a nodule near her right lung that could very well be her cancer returning.

She has surgery to try to remove it all tomorrow (Friday) at the Children's Hospital in Pittsburgh.

One thing that has gotten her through everything so far is her love for the Pittsburgh Steelers, particularly player Troy Polamalu.

The other thing that gives her strength is her F.R.O.G. belief... Fully Rely on God, which her family made into bracelets (like the LiveStrong ones) that loved ones wear in solidarity.
